What's The Definition Of Jerker?
[n] someone who gives a strong sudden pull
Synonyms | Synonyms for Jerker: yanker Related Terms | Find terms related to Jerker: See Also | puller Jerker In Webster's Dictionary \Jerk"er\, n.
1. A beater. [Obs.] --Beau. & Fl.
2. One who jerks or moves with a jerk.
3. (Zo["o]l.) A North American river chub ({Hybopsis
biguttatus}).
